Upcoming Activities
Our Adventurers (high-school age boys) and Navigators (middle-school) are being oriented in their programs and event planning, while our Woodlands (elementary age) boys have had an introduction into Trail Life by learning about our Flag (week 1), our Faith (week 2), and Manners (this week). After that introductory course, the fun factor will kick up a notch. We will be exploring the Hobbies and Outdoor Skills branches between now and fall break. And some of our Woodlands will get to Hit the Trail soon, too. What is a Hit the Trail? It's a "field trip" that we take, once for each of our seven Woodlands core branches: Heritage, Life Skills, Values, Hobbies, Science & Technology, Sports and Fitness, and Outdoor Skills. If you're a Woodlands parent, read about the branches with your son starting on page 24 of the Woodlands Trail Handbook.
